WebLewis structure of the tetrafluoroborate ion, BrF 4−. The molecule will have a total of 36 valence electrons −7 from bromine, 7 from each of the four fluorine atoms, and one extra electron to given the ion the −1 charge. WebSF4 Sulfur Tetrafluoride. Sulfur tetrafluoride has 5 regions of electron density around the central sulfur atom (4 bonds and one lone pair). Web29. dec 2024. · The electron geometry of SF 4 is trigonal bipyramidal. In the Lewis dot structure of SF 4, there are a total of 4 bond pairs and 1 lone pair around the central sulfur atom. The central S atom in SF 4 is sp 3 d hybridized.
